Output 30561657509fe50850948f523640c0505dd073dcc163f06ed684a8e7c52a333b:14

value
26899834
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0ba163f5fc53184d025489b12680d4ffae61ee2 OP_EQUALVERIFY OP_CHECKSIG
address
1Fer3EnVryTX4QEPEAcyEaTAFqeuHEFGFP
transaction
30561657509fe50850948f523640c0505dd073dcc163f06ed684a8e7c52a333b
spent
true